
Christian Schladetsch wrote:
That simply isn't true, unfortunately. DirectX and OpenGL have different abstractions for the same hardware, and what's worse is that the hardware itself is changing even faster than the API's that access it.
That is far different to the API's that deal with threads. To make matters worse, OpenGL is a few generations behind DirectX (sorry, but it's true), and the gap is only increasing with Geometry Shaders.
The reality is that DirectX provides the best API to use hardware, OpenGL wont and can't compete at that level because unlike DirectX, OpenGL is not driving the hardware industry.
Wasn't that stuff like Ogre3d do somehow. That's ages i didn't dip into these so take this question as a real naive one for the sake of the argument. -- ___________________________________________ Joel Falcou - Assistant Professor PARALL Team - LRI - Universite Paris Sud XI Tel : (+33)1 69 15 66 35